What is a store event coordinator?

Store Event Coordinators are professionals responsible for planning, organizing, and executing in-store events to attract customers and promote products or services. They collaborate with store management, vendors, and marketing teams to create engaging experiences such as product launches, demonstrations, or seasonal celebrations. Their duties include managing event logistics, overseeing budgets, coordinating staff, and ensuring events run smoothly. Store Event Coordinators play a key role in enhancing customer engagement and driving sales through memorable in-store activities.

How does a store event coordinator typically collaborate with other departments to ensure successful event execution?

A Store Event Coordinator works closely with various departments such as marketing, merchandising, and sales to plan and execute in-store events. They coordinate with marketing teams to promote the event, partner with merchandising to ensure products are showcased effectively, and communicate with store staff to manage logistics on the event day. This collaborative approach helps address potential challenges like inventory management or customer flow, ensuring events run smoothly and meet business objectives. Regular meetings and clear communication are essential for aligning goals and resolving any issues that arise during planning and execution.

Job description

Job Description:

At Main Event, our Event Coordinators help our Guest's plan memorable birthday and event experiences, by creating a vision of FUN! As an Event Coordinator, you will partner with our Guests to create a tailored and memorable experience based on their needs. You're also dedicated to delivering the highest standards in safety and sanitation.

WHAT WILL YOU BE DOING DAILY?

  • Upholding our cleanliness and safety standards (We take this seriously!)
  • Welcoming and engaging with all Guests, all while being an ambassador of FUN
  • Understanding all aspects of our event packages, and add-ons
  • Selling, scheduling and coordinating corporate, group, and birthday events (let the FUN begin!)
  • Utilizing systems and programs to input sales revenue, guest information, and create follow up tasks related to the business
  • Partnering with the Sales Manager to exceed budgeted birthday, group and event sales targets, and achieve quarterly sales plans
  • Prospecting and cold calling to develop ongoing relationships for new and repeat business
  • Supporting local store marketing initiatives to drive walk-in and event sales
  • Attending and engaging in weekly sales meetings to share strategic ideas that support the business
  • Performing opening, mid-day or closing duties

POSITION REQUIREMENTS

  • Prior food & beverage or retail experience; sales experience a plus
  • Guest focused mindset (We heart our Guests!)
  • Teamwork is a must (Teamwork makes the dream work!)
  • Relationship building (very important!)
  • Proficient in software such as; Excel, Microsoft Office and CRM
  • Can effectively communicate with Management, Team Members, and Guests
  • Availability to work days, nights and/or weekends and holidays
